Analysis and Improvement of Factors Influencing Blending Uniformity in Primary Processing

  • In order to blend the cut tobacco in a processing batch more precisely and ensure blend consistency, all factors influencing blending processing were analysed on an instantaneous precision basis, and the screen for dried cut strips and proportioning weigher were improved. A loosening device was installed above the vibration screen to loosen tangled tobacco and optimize its size composition, and a spreader was installed at the discharge end of the proportioning weigher to avoid tobacco jam and ensure the continuity of tobacco flow. The results showed that:1) Tobacco loosening, the uniformity and stability of instantaneous flow were the key factors influencing the consistency of tobacco makeup in a cigarette;2)After improvement, the instantaneous blending precision reduced from 1.84% to 1.09% and the deviation of actual makeup in cigarettes decreased from 1.30% to 0.79%. Tobacco was well loosened and tobacco jam avoided, the quality control and process control in cigarette manufacturing were effectively improved.
